Michelle and Clint, I've tried a number of times to propagate from leaves. Here's what I found out. If the leaf has a bit of stem on it, then there is a good chance it will root and grow. However, if the leaf doesn't have any stem, then I always lost it. Be sure to not let them dry out. Mist daily and keep out of hot sun. I hope you have better success than I did.
You can start a lot of semps quickly by cutting sections of stems that have leaves, then growing them. It's easy to lose the starts if they dry out too much. You might want to try this technique on a variety that you have plenty.
